CASTLE KART Disposable Mini Soap Paper Travel Hand Washing Box-X53(3 x 16.67 g)

Search and compare best available prices of CASTLE KART Disposable Mini Soap Paper Travel Hand Washing Box-X53(3 x 16.67 g) from leading online shopping websites in India.